YOUR NEXT OPPORTUNITY

The Assistant Project Manager is an entry-level project management position and is expected to learn and develop competency in the Essential Duties and Responsibilities. In addition, the APM is responsible for providing administrative and construction support for our Project Management team.

WHAT YOU’LL DO
  • Manage project documentation, including submittals, RFIs, (Return for Information), and meeting minutes.
  • Oversee project activities as assigned by the Project Manager, including planning, coordinating, circumventing/resolving problem areas, ensuring all company/project policies, procedures, and standards are maintained, etc.
  • Maintain change orders, submittal, and document (drawing) control logs.
  • Prepare required logs and other project documentation for construction meetings.
  • Responsible for contract submittals that are accurate and timely.
  • Responsible for creating and issuing the Subcontractors’ contracts.
  • Responsible for the assembly and timely delivery of the Owner and Maintenance Manuals.
  • Ensure that the project quality control plan is followed.
  • Interacts with subcontractors to ensure we have obtained the correct documentation and drawing for the Owner and Maintenance Manuals.
  • Responsible for keeping the Warranty Log up to date.
  • Attend company/project meetings with clients, subcontractors, etc., and provide project management support.
  • Cooperate with and technically assist field personnel assigned to the area of responsibility.
  • Monitor other contractors’ activities and progress.
  • Responsible for creating the Job Information Sheets and establishing Job Files.
  • Prepares price change orders and project reports and documentation.
  • Works with payroll to ensure accurate payroll information.

TRAVEL

Up to 25%

WORKING CONDITIONS

General work environment – This position is performed primarily on active construction sites. Activity includes sitting for extended periods, standing, walking, typing, carrying, pushing, bending. Work is conducted primarily indoors with varying environmental conditions, such as fluorescent lighting and air conditioning. Noise level is typically low to medium. Occasional lifting of up to 30 lbs.
